Fct. 1.07 Lower
Dead Zone
(LOW DZ)
Specifies the distance from the
bottom of the sensor in which no
measurement takes place. On
cable sensors, this includes the
weight.
When material is tracked into
the Lower Dead Zone the output
indicates the bottom of the probe
and remains there until the level
increased above this area.
Changing Material Type, Fct.
1.05, or Probe Type, Fct A.06,
will reset this function to factory
default values.
Editing this function changes
Material Type, Fct 1.05, to “CUS-
TOM”
Increase value
from factory set-
ting as required.
Default depen-
dent Probe Type
and Material Type
Do not decrease
value below
factory setting
without factory
consultation.

Fct. 1.09 Threshold Sets minimum amplitude for
valid signal level detection.
Preset to 1200 for insulating
liquids (Material Type selection
“OIL”), or 1500 for conductive
liquids (Material Type selection
“WATER”).
Editing this function changes
Material Type, Fct 1.05, to “CUS-
TOM”
User editable
value
0 - 20000
Do not change
without Factory
consultation.

Fct. 1.10 Signal
Area
(SG
AREA)
Sets minimum area for valid
signal level detection. Used to
discriminate a valid level signal
vs. an excursion such as a noise
spike.
Preset to 7500 for Hydrocarbon
(Material Type selection “Oil”),
or 20000 for Aqueous liquids
(Material Type selection “Wa-
ter”).
Editing this function changes
Material Type, Fct 1.05, to “CUS-
TOM”
User editable
value
0 - 32000
Do not change
without Factory
consultation.
